Django调试工具栏是一个很好的工具来分析慢速SQL查询 - 除其他外。我可以在我的Django应用程序中为GET响应执行此操作。我的问题是:我如何分析(和优化)我的POST响应?
答案 0 :(得分:5)
Django-Debug-Toolbar与GET和POST请求的工作方式相同。
但是,一种常见的UI设计模式是成功的表单提交会导致重定向,这会加载新视图并使您丢失DDT中的所有SQL历史记录。
如果是这种情况,DDT上的其中一个面板允许您拦截重定向并在每一步检查SQL查询。
此外,如果你的问题来自于调用AJAX,你应该看一下这个问题的答案:How to use django-debug-toolbar on AJAX calls?